Wenwei Zhang is a scholar working on Molecular Biology, Electrical and Electronic Engineering and Plant Science. According to data from OpenAlex, Wenwei Zhang has authored 25 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 7 papers in Electrical and Electronic Engineering and 4 papers in Plant Science. Recurrent topics in Wenwei Zhang’s work include Advanced Battery Materials and Technologies (5 papers), Advanced battery technologies research (5 papers) and Gamma-Aminobutyric Acid Metabolism in Plants (4 papers). Wenwei Zhang is often cited by papers focused on Advanced Battery Materials and Technologies (5 papers), Advanced battery technologies research (5 papers) and Gamma-Aminobutyric Acid Metabolism in Plants (4 papers). Wenwei Zhang collaborates with scholars based in China, United States and Singapore. Wenwei Zhang's co-authors include Terry G. Unterman, Robert V. Farese, Mini P. Sajan, Seung‐Hoi Koo, D.R. Powell, Roberta Franks, Patrick Tso, Donna B. Stolz, Marc Montminy and Shaodong Guo and has published in prestigious journals such as Journal of the American Chemical Society, Journal of Biological Chemistry and Energy & Environmental Science.
